Jaime Valencia Tue, 01/13/2009 - 21:25
User Badges:
  • Cisco Employee,
  • Hall of Fame,


you can use BAT for that purpose but only when inserting them, not updating them



if this helps, please rate

testeven Wed, 01/14/2009 - 10:07
User Badges:
  • Cisco Employee,


As it was said, BAT does not work for subscribing or unsubscribing services to the IP Phones when updating phones. The only way to do this with BAT is when you are inserting phones, meaning that you would need to delete a phone and readd it with the Template that has the IP Phone Service you want. However, there was a bug filled for this:


Externally found enhancement defect: Resolved (R)

BAT to support subscribing users to PAB and Fast Dial Services


Cannot subscribe the users to IP Phone services like Personal Address Book

and Fast Dials through BAT. This applies to any IP Phone services.


The problem exists in all the BAT versions



After adding the Phones/Users through BAT, one has to manually go to each user page and subscribe the users/phones to these services,

enter the PIN, User ID manually.

The bug applies to CCM 4.X versions and it was fixed on 5.0

If you have a 4.X version you can export all the IP phones using 'Export all details' option then insert phones with 'All Details' option and adding the IP phone service you want.

Hope this helps and have a nice day!


michaeljbyrne Thu, 01/15/2009 - 07:11
User Badges:

So I have to hit every phone manually? There has got to be another way.

ranpierce Thu, 01/15/2009 - 07:33
User Badges:
  • Silver, 250 points or more

I have done it manually also. evertime there is a new hire. =)


michaeljbyrne Thu, 01/15/2009 - 07:37
User Badges:

new hire I can understand. We just created a custom directory and need to push it out to about 175 users.

Jonathan Schulenberg Tue, 01/20/2009 - 17:49
User Badges:
  • Super Bronze, 10000 points or more
  • Cisco Designated VIP,

    2017 IP Telephony

In UCM 7.0 I believe there is an Enterprise Subscription option that you can check when creating the service that will subscribe it to all phones one time.

Adam Thompson Mon, 01/19/2009 - 08:06
User Badges:
  • Silver, 250 points or more

If you are using CCM 4.x, you should be able to update all of the phones to assign up to 2 IP Services. The only thing you can't do is assign the user specific login information, if it is necessary.

(BAT -> Configure -> Phones -> Update Phones -> "your query" -> Check IP Services -> select service to assign)

Another option is, if the users have access to their phone user page, to have them self subscribe the service. This gets you out of having to touch all 175 phones, and if your communication to the users is clear enough, you won't end up with 175 support calls.


This Discussion